After more than six months of planning, a major art project is underway at Emerald House in South Melbourne AUSTRALIA. Covering more than 800 square meters of space, the project will become Australia's largest exhibition of graffiti art, painted directly onto the walls of the buildings car park by some of the world's most renowned artists.
Around 90 artists will contribute to the exhibition, with many hailing from Australia as well as some from as far away as New York, Paris and Amsterdam. The likes of Phibs, Ces, Sirum1 and Vans are among those to spray and stencil their way into Australian graffiti art history.
Throughout the duration of the project, workshops are being run for young people from Melbourne, to help build their self-esteem and confidence, and show how their talents can be used in a legal and productive way.
